Output 80e99312399770cce3716b029f70334ea49deb387056694cecd05ec3b850c42c:1

value
17221332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1b1c776ba71f34f10a05fe523390633bdc82d3f OP_EQUAL
address
3Lon7wyGrsQokykXtmgF1tnSfjLLJyFec3
transaction
80e99312399770cce3716b029f70334ea49deb387056694cecd05ec3b850c42c
spent
true